      High-Precision Rotary Filling and Capping for Pilot Production

      For pilot-scale production, maintaining flexibility and precision is crucial. Pharmasys’ rotary capping machines for pilot lines offer multiple capping methods, including knife capping and claw locking, allowing pharmaceutical manufacturers to adapt to various vial specifications without compromising on aseptic integrity. The integration of a flexible manipulator vacuum capping system ensures that each vial is sealed reliably while reducing potential environmental, health, and safety (EHS) hazards associated with manual handling.

      Equipped with a servo-driven mechanism, these machines provide high-precision control over capping pressure. This enables operators to fine-tune the capping force according to vial type and filling material, ensuring that even sensitive biological formulations remain stable and contamination-free throughout the process.

      Automated Loading and Capping Workflow

      Pharmasys’ automatic loading and capping features significantly reduce manual labor and increase operational efficiency. Vials can be automatically loaded into the system, capped with precision, and discharged for downstream processing. The no vial, no capping safety interlock prevents equipment damage and production errors, while tool-less quick change parts facilitate fast adjustments for different vial specifications, reducing downtime and production delays.

      Furthermore, these machines can seamlessly connect with upstream and downstream equipment, offering full integration into pilot and small-batch production lines. This interoperability allows for scalable production without the need for extensive reconfiguration.

      Multiple Sealing Methods and High Flexibility

      Different production requirements call for specialized sealing methods. Pharmasys’ rotary capping machines support a variety of capping options, including single knife, claw type, and advanced vacuum sealing. The adoption of high-precision servo drives ensures consistent torque and pressure during the capping process, minimizing the risk of leaks and contamination. Operators benefit from easy adjustments for pressing force, enabling the safe handling of vials filled with highly sensitive injectables or viscous formulations.

      The flexible manipulator technology also enables precise handling of vials in constrained environments, making it ideal for integration with isolators or contained environments such as orabs and crabs, which are often used in high-risk aseptic filling operations.
